Output 31fcb034e53a07158e8e995922e4beed90477116b5ea213829b0ef79a7242c1d:0

value
80220446
script pubkey
OP_0 OP_PUSHBYTES_20 3ae8375e960d63e3ba1769760af249bc9b623707
address
bc1q8t5rwh5kp4378wshd9mq4ujfhjdkydc8dycff3
transaction
31fcb034e53a07158e8e995922e4beed90477116b5ea213829b0ef79a7242c1d